JavaWeb-03-Servlet-08-Http状态1.状态介绍1.状态是由三位数字组成的符号。2.Http服务器在推送响应包前,根据本次请求处理情况,将Http状态写入到响应包里的【状态行】上。3.如果Http服务器针对本次请求,返回了对应的资源文件,那么就通过Http状态通知浏览器该如何处理这个结果;如果Http服务器针对本次请求,没有返回对应的资源文件,那么就通过Http状态
1.Http状态这些状态分为五大:100-199 用于指定客户端应相应的某些动作。 200-299 用于表示请求成功。 300-399 用于已经移动的文件并且常被包含在定位头信息中指定新的地址信息。 400-499 用于指出客户端的错误。 500-599 用于支持服务器错误。100 (Continue/继续)如果服务器收到头信息中带有100-conti
转载 2023-08-04 13:07:38
59阅读
# Java 状态自带的探秘 在 Java 编程语言中,状态是一个用于表示不同状态或条件的数字。状态通常用于 HTTP 响应、API 调用、异常处理等场景。而 Java 提供了一些自带,以简化这些状态的使用和管理。本文将探讨 Java 中的状态自带,并通过代码示例加以说明。 ## 1. 什么是状态状态是一个代表某种状态的数字,通常与返回的信息一同传递,以便用户或系统解
原创 11月前
48阅读
# 如何实现Java状态枚举 ## 1. 事情流程 我们首先需要了解整个实现Java状态枚举的流程,在这个过程中,我们会创建一个枚举,用来定义不同状态以及对应的信息。 下面是实现Java状态枚举的步骤: | 步骤 | 描述 | | :---: | :--- | | 1 | 创建一个枚举,用来定义状态和对应的信息。 | | 2 | 在枚举中添加私有变量和构造函数。 | |
原创 2024-03-19 03:38:10
174阅读
Java线程的状态及转换线程状态及其转换线程的状态详细介绍:新建状态(NEW):就绪状态(RUNNABLE):运行状态(RUNNING):阻塞状态(BLOCKED):等待状态(WAITING):睡眠等待状态(TIMED_WAITING)终止状态(TERMINATED)线程状态的转换 线程状态及其转换线程的状态线程的状态,在java中是提供了枚举类型的State。public enum State
转载 2023-07-21 23:58:24
94阅读
学习记录17一、Http状态 1、介绍Status Code,由三位数字组成的符号Http服务器在推送响应包之前,根据本次请求处理情况,将Http状态写入到响应包中的状态行上若Http服务器针对请求,返回了对应的资源文件:通过状态通知浏览器如何使用处理资源文件若Http服务器针对请求,无法返回资源文件:通过状态向浏览器解释不返回资源文件原因2、分类组成:100——599 共分为5个大类1X
前言:这篇文章作为中间件的回显的开头笔记,最一开始了解的回显就是有听说过中间件的回显,今天大概翻看了些文章,对于回显应该还是有很多方法的,就比如 写文件回显、dnslog、URLClassLoader抛出异常等等很多方式都可以实现回显的操作,这里的话就先了解Tomcat中间件的回显学习。参考文章:https://xz.aliyun.com/t/9914Tomcat 6/7/8/9全版本回显这里在讲
转载 2024-07-07 16:42:28
25阅读
不变模式 1、一个对象的状态在对象被创建之后就不再变化,这就是不变模式(缺少改变自身状态的行为),不变模式只涉及一个,一个的内部状态创建后,在整个生命周期都不会发生变化,这个叫不变,而不变模式就是使用这种类。 2、不变模式的两种形式:弱不变模式与强不变模式 弱不变模式:一个的实例的状态是不可变的,但是这个的子类的实例具有可能会变化的状态。 实现条件: 1、所考虑对象没有任何方法会修
## Java 订单状态枚举 在开发过程中,订单状态是一个常见的需求。为了规范和统一订单状态的定义和使用,我们可以使用枚举来表示订单状态。枚举是一种特殊的,它的实例是有限的、固定的,并且可以在代码中直接使用。 ### 1. 定义订单状态枚举 我们可以定义一个枚举 `OrderStatus` 来表示订单的不同状态。这个枚举包含了订单的所有可能状态,每个状态都有一个对应的状态
原创 2024-01-04 11:22:54
435阅读
参考: https://www.cnblogs.com/liangxiaofeng/p/5798607.html
转载 2019-08-16 02:07:00
96阅读
2评论
这里先说结论:对于一组关联的数值,出于对数据安全的考虑,我们选择使用enum。问题定义表结构的时候经常会碰到一字段:状态 ( status 或者 state ) 、类型 ( type ) ,而通常的做法一般是:数据库 中定义 tinyint 类型。 比如:status tinyint(1) NOT NULL COMMENT ‘订单状态 1-待支付;2-待发货;3-待收货;4-已收货;5-已完结;
文章目录一、背景及定义二、枚举的使用1.switch2.常用方法(1) values() 方法(2) valueOf ()(3) compareTo() 方法3.构造方法三、枚举和反射总结 一、背景及定义枚举是在JDK1.5以后引入的。主要用途是:将一组常量组织起来,在这之前表示一组常量通常使用定义常量的方式。public static int final RED = 1; public sta
转载 2023-10-17 11:29:56
114阅读
1.HttpServletResponse 对象1.1发送状态的相关方法setStatus(int status):该方法用于设置HTTP响应消息的状态。并生成响应状态行。sendError(int sc):该方法用于发送表示错误信息的状态。例如,404状态码表示找不到客户端请求的资源。1.2发送响应消息体相关的方法1.getOutputStream()方法 该方法所获取的字节输出流对象为
转载 2023-10-04 09:56:32
101阅读
背景: 在工作中我们都会创建一些静态常量,例如:// 春天 private static final String SPRING = 1;这种定义方式看似十分简单,但是其实是存在很多问题的:就是在使用过程中,别的开发人员会把你定义的常量用作别的用途,比如上面可能会被用作与别的数相加等等;所以这个时候就需要就需要使用枚举,java5新增了enum关键字(它与calss、interface关键字的地位
00000 一切 ok 正确执行后的返回 A0001 用户端错误 一级宏观错误码 A0100 用户注册错误 二级宏观错误码 A0101 用户未同意隐私协议 A0102 注册国家或地区受限 A0110 用户名校验失败 A0111 用户名已存在 A0112 用户名包含敏感词 A0113 用户名包含特殊字符 A0120 密码校验失败 A0121 密码长度不够 A0122 密码强度不够 A0130 校验
转载 2023-07-23 20:18:00
210阅读
1、异常体系: 图片来源:Trowable有两个子类:Error和Exception:Error: 是与虚拟机有关的异常,如:系统崩溃,动态链接失败,虚拟机错误(AWTError、IOError),是不能捕获; Jvm的内存消耗完会报的OutOfMemoryError,这种错误发生后,JVM就会停止线程;Exception 包含RuntimeException和checkException异常 R
转载 2023-11-09 07:41:16
56阅读
http状态返回代码 1xx(临时响应) 表示临时响应并需要请求者继续执行操作的状态代码。http状态返回代码 100 (继续) 请求者应当继续提出请求。 服务器返回此代码表示已收到请求的第一部分,正在等待其余部分。 101 (切换协议) 请求者已要求服务器切换协议,服务器已确认并准备切换。http状态返回代码 2xx (成功) 表示成功处理了请求的状态代码。http状态返回代码 200 (成功)
转载 2023-09-09 21:04:57
131阅读
HTTP状态(HTTP Status Code)一些常见的状态为:200 - 服务器成功返回网页 404 - 请求的网页不存在 503 - 服务不可用 所有状态解释:点击查看1xx(临时响应) 表示临时响应并需要请求者继续执行操作的状态代码。 代码 说明 100 (继续) 请求者应当继续提出请求。 服务器返回此代码表示已收
转载 2023-07-21 16:55:56
124阅读
2开头:(请求成功)表示成功处理了请求的状态代码、200:(成功)服务器已成功处理了请求。通常,这表示服务器提供了请求的网页。201:(已创建)请求成功并且服务器创建了新的资源202:(已接受)服务器已接受请求,但尚未处理203:(非授权信息)服务器已成功处理了请求,但返回的信息可能来自另一资源。204:(无内容)服务器成功处理了请求,但没有返回任何内容205:(重置内容)服务器成功处理了请求,但
转载 2023-07-28 10:39:51
150阅读
  • 1
  • 2
  • 3
  • 4
  • 5